Your Opportunity + Impact

The Designer will apply basic to intermediate engineering and/or landscape architecture principles to complete design computations, prepare written technical reports, design plans, and details. This position may be called upon to make minor project decisions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Uses CAD, Revit, and other software programs relative to the discipline to develop technically accurate, clean and deliverable drawings.
  • Reviews work to ensure accuracy, makes corrections to work from red lines, and backchecks.
  • Writes specifications, reviews submittals, and coordinates project submissions.
  • Coordinates the preparation of advanced multi-discipline drawing sets as required for assigned projects, including coordination with technical, administrative, and other design staff.
  • Promotes, utilizes, and supports quality assurance and quality control processes to improve the quality of deliverables and reduce design errors & omissions.
  • Researches, reviews, interprets, and understands written design standards, regulations, code compliance, and permit requirements and applies them to design projects.
  • Independently creates standard details for projects as directed.
  • Reviews shop drawings and working drawing submissions from contractors.
  • Assists with design calculations, calculates quantities, reviews technical specifications, and prepares cost estimates.
